        This study aims to examine the effect of Genetically Modified β -Carotene Biofortified Rice rice developed by simultaneous expression technology in NAAS on biological immunity. Accordingly, this study added Genetically Modified β-Carotene Biofortified Rice 25, 50% and general rice 50% as control group into diet and provided rats with the prescribed feeds and then measured the contents of immunoglobulin and cytokine in blood. As a result, male and female IgM, IgE, male IgG1, female IgG2a and TNF-a, IL5 and IL12 showed no significant difference; male IgG2a tended to decrease dependently on the combined concentration of Genetically Modified β-Carotene Biofortified Rice; female IgG1 showed significance with control group, but its association with diet was not found. The higher the dietary mixing ratio, the more the male and female IFN-a and female IL-4 contents, regardless of rice variety, and it was found that female IL6 content decreased significantly, but its association with diet was not found. The risk of beta carotene-enriched rice into environment and human body has not been reported yet. The digestion of Genetically Modified β-Carotene Biofortified Rice can be seen as "safe" as this test result showed no big difference between general rice and Genetically Modified β-Carotene Biofortified Rice, and its usability is full of suggestions.

        This study was a survey of consumer awareness and attitudes about genetically modified foods and their labeling regulations. Questionnaires were distributed to 4,620 consumers who lived in different areas of Korea, and 4,076 people responded. The consumers were asked about knowledge, labeling information, and their sources of information about GM foods. Respondents from Seoul, Jeonnam, and Gyeongnam answered mostly "nearly don't know > moderate > never know > know a little." Respondents from Gyeonggi answered "moderate > nearly don't know > never know > know a little." According to occupation, housewives, company employees, consultants, and students answered mostly "nearly don't know > moderate > never know > know a little. "Consumers answered about the intent to buy GM foods differently according to area, occupation, and education. Seoul and Gyeonggi residents said that reinforcing factors to relieve the insecurity of GM foods were "evaluating safety > management of GM foods by the government > GM food regulation system." There were other answers according to area, occupation, and education. About GM-related education methods that they wished to have, residents of the Seoul area said "books/leaflets" most often, but residents of the Gyounggi area said "attending a lecture" most often. Housewives also said "attending a lecture," but teachers and students said "Internetbased education" most often. About the kinds of education that they could join, Seoul residents answered "consumer groups > school parents > public institutions," but Gyeonggi and Chungnam area residents answered "public institutions > consumer groups > school parents." Housewives and students answered "consumer groups" most often, but consultants and private business owners answered "public institutions" most often. We realized that different education methods were necessary for different areas, occupations, and education levels.

        Although the National Institute of Health (NIH, USA) miniature pigs were developed specifically for xenotransplantation, the cloning efficiency is still very low. To increase the efficiency, an advanced somatic cell nuclear transfer (SCNT) method may need. In the present study, we report the productions of genetically modified cloned pigs using the frozen-thawed donor cells without culture before SCNT. Fibroblasts were isolated from an ear skin of a 10-day-old NIH miniature pig. The fibroblast cells were genetically modified with the human CD73 (hCD73). For SCNT, somatic cells transfected with hCD73 were used as donor cells. The survival rate of the somatic cells was significantly higher in 0 h (95%) compared with 1 h (81%) after thawing (p<0.05). We obtained the pregnancy (38.9%, 7/18) and delivery (11.1%, 2/18) rate, respectively. Totally 7 genetically modified cloned piglets were delivered. Among them, 2 piglets were survived and 5 piglets were born stillbirth. The healthy 2 piglets are still survived (≥6 months).

        A survey of consumer awareness and attitudes was conducted about genetically modified (GM) foods and the labeling regulations. The questionnaires were distributed to 4,620 consumers who lived in a variety of areas in Korea, and 4,076 people responded. The consumers were asked about knowledge, labeling information, and the source of obtaining information about GM foods. More than 11.5% of the consumers had never heard about GM foods and 86.9% of consumers had less than a normal level of knowledge about GM foods. No statistically significant relationship was found between genders, but the teachers group had moderate knowledge (p<0.001). In total, 28.4% of consumers did not know the GMO labeling regulations. They answered that the reason to buy GM food was do not know>nothing wrong>create benefit>think as safe>inexpensive. The answers to the question of what was the first benefit were: solve food shortage>functional and nutritious food>cultivate in bad condition>nothing>various cultivars. They answered that the worst factor was the next generation effect>environmental disruption. Regarding the development of GM food in Korea, males answered do not know>stronglyrecommend>defer>strongly suppress. Female answered: don't know>defer>strongly recommend>strongly suppress. More than half of the respondents did not have much information about GM foods; 88.3% of respondents answered they did not have educational experience about GM food.

        Field studies were conducted to assess potential effects of transgenic rice expressing Bacillus thuringiensis (Bt) CryIAc1 protein, which is highly effective the rice leafroller, Cnaphalocrocis medinalis, on the rice insect community in 2007 and 2008. Insects were sampled in non-Bt and Bt rice plots with a sweep net and a suction devise. A total of 64,256 individuals in 45 families and 11 orders (30,860 individuals in 43 families and 11 orders in the Bt-rice plots, and 33,396 individuals in 40 families and 11 order in the non-Bt rice plots) were captured and grouped by ecological functional guilds. Species diversity and richness were not significantly different between Bt-rice and non-Bt rice plots. The seasonal pattern of the insect community and the seasonal population fluctuation of insects were very similar between two plots. Collectively, the rice insect community was not influenced by the Bt-rice in the present study.

        미국, 일본과 우리나라 모두 종자에 대해 품종보호제도와 특허제도에 의한 중복보호를 부여하고 있다. GM종자의 경우 유전형질변환과정에 인간의 창작이 개입되었기 때문에 특허로 보호받을 수 있을 것이지만, 여전히‘종자’이므로 품종보호제도를 통한 보호도 가능할 것인데 품종보호제도 혹은 특허제도 중 어느 것으로 보호받을지는 발명자의 선택사항이다. GM종자와 관련하여 두 제도의 가장 큰 차이점은 권리의 효력제한 범위이다. 각국별로 다소 차이는 있지만 품종보호제도에서는 일반적으로 농부의 자가채종행위에는 품종보호권(혹은 육성자권)의 효력이 미치지 않는다는 명문의 규정을 두어 인류의 역사에서 오래된 관행을 인정하고 있지만 특허제도에는 이에 대응하는 명문의 규정이 없고 특허제품의 최초판매에 의해 판매된 물건에 대해서는 특허권의 소진한다는 판례법상의 원칙이 GM종자 발명에는 어떻게 적용될 것인지가 문제가 된다. 미국의 GM콩종자 사건에서 문제가 된 것은 조건부 판매에 의해 특허권의 소진이 제한되는지와 자기복제발명의 경우 소진을 어떻게 적용할 것인지였는데, 첫 번째 쟁점에 대한 미국과 일본에서의 논의를 정리해 보면, 미국 CAFC의 Mallinckrodt 판결 하에서 계약에 의한 소진회피 가능성은 높았지만 Quanta 판결에 의해 그 여지가 많이 줄어들었다고 볼 수 있고 일본의 경우는 원칙적으로는 불가하고 소유권유보나 해제조건부 라이센스 등 매우 제한적인 가능성만이 열려 있다고 볼 수 있다. 다만 미국과 일본 모두 판례에 대한 비판적 견해가 제기되는 것을 보면‘특허권자의 계약방법 선택의 자유’ 와 ‘제3자의 거래안전 보호’라는 상충하는 이익의 조화를 꾀할 수 있는 결론 및 그 이론구성에 대해 향후 지속적인 검토가 필요할 것으로 보인다. 두 번째 쟁점과 관련하여서는 후세대 종자에 대한 소진의 적용을 배제한 연방순회항소법원의 결론에는 동의하지만 후세대 종자가 판매된 적이 없다는 논거보다는‘생산’이라는 개념을 기준으로 판단하는 것이 타당하지 않은가 생각된다.

        This study was aimed to develop a novel qualitative multiplex polymerase chain reaction (PCR) for simultaneous detection of genetically modified (GM) soy and maize within a single reaction. The specific primers designed to detect four respective GM events (A2704-12, MON88017, Bt11, and MON863) were included in the tetraplex PCR system. Each of PCR products for four GM events could be distinguished by agarose gel based on their different lengths. The specificity and reproducibility of this multiplex PCR were evaluated. This multiplex PCR consistently amplified only a fragment corresponding to a specific inserted gene in each of the four GM events and also amplified all four of the PCR products in the simulated GM mixture. These results indicate that this multiplex PCR method could be an effective qualitative detection method for screening GM soy and maize in a single reaction.

        The effects of the genetically modified virus-resistant pepper (line: H15) and the Non-GM pepper (line: P2377) on the insect community in the pepper cultivation area were evaluated. Sampling was conducted using yellow sticky traps and pheromone funnel traps in Anseong and Deokso fields. Total number of insects caught on sticky trap were 3924 individuals at GM pepper and 3670 individuals at Non-GM pepper in Anseong and 2362 individuals at GM and 2528 individuals at Non-GM in Deokso, respectively. The total number of the insect individuals caught by sticky trap was not shown significant differences between GM and Non-GM pepper at Anseong and Deokso fields, respectively. The number of aphids per sticky trap ranged from 11.60±2.02 to 1.92±0.96 at Non-GM and from 11.56±2.15 to 0.33±0.23 at GM in Anseong, and from 2.78±1.22 to 0.11±0.08 and from 2.73±0.84 to 0.11±0.08 at Non-GM and GM pepper in Deokso, respectively. There were no significant differences in seasonal occurrences of aphids caught on sticky traps in GM and Non-GM pepper at both fields, and significant differences in aphids population density between Non-GM and GM were not observed.

        The effects of the genetically modified virus-resistant pepper (line: 15, 20) and the non-GM pepper (line: 2377, 915) on the insect community in the pepper cultivation area were evaluated. Sampling was conducted using yellow sticky traps and pheromone funnel traps in Anseong and Deokso fields. Total number of insects caught on sticky trap were 3273 individuals at GM pepper and 2949 individuals at non-GM pepper in Anseong and 4357 individuals at GM and 3712 individuals at non-GM in Deokso. Total number of aphids collected on leaves were 451 and 330 individuals at GM and non-GM pepper in Anseong, respectively and 79 individuals at GM and 41 individuals at non-GM pepper in Deokso. The total number of the insect individuals caught on sticky trap was not shown significant differences between GM and non-GM pepper at Anseong and Deokso fields, respectively. Also, there were no significant differences in seasonal occurrences of aphids caught on sticky traps in GM and non-GM pepper at both fields.         For the physiological study on environmental impact of genetically modified (GM) pepper plant on non-target but three-trophically related insect species, we investigated behavioral responses of Aphis gossypii and Aphidius colemani in Y-tube olfactometer to the cucumber mosaic virus (CMV)-resistant transgenic pepper plant (H15 GM line) expressing coat protein gene of CMV and its wild type pepper plant (untransformed, susceptible to CMV pathotype II, P2377 inbred line) in relation to CMV infection. CMV-infected plants were prepared with the 30 min of inoculation by the winged A. gossypii viruliferous or mechanical inoculation using CMV-Fny, and with molecular diagnosis using reverse transcriptase-polymerase chain reaction (RT-PCR) over 2 weeks after inoculation. In this study, time for attraction responses (attraction time) of A. gossypii were not significantly different in the pepper strain, and the virus infection of plant. However, the attraction time of A. colemani was significantly different between the GM plant and the non-GM plant. In addition, the attraction time of A. colemani to the GM plant was significantly decreased according to the CMV infection. For further study, the volatile organic compounds (VOCs) emitted by these plants were collected with an entrainment kit and analyzed by Gas Chromatography (GC) on HP-1 column. The specific VOCs related to CMV infection were detected in the GM plant over 4 weeks after inoculation of CMV in this study. Thus, it is suggested that VOCs of the GM plant in this study may be produced more as a signal attracting A. colemani in relation to CMV infection.

        A survey on consumer’s awareness and perception toward genetically-modified (GM) foods was conducted on 2110 random samples of Korean consumers. More than 65% of the respondents were exposed to some information related to GM foods. The respondents answered that the greatest benefit of the development of GM foods is remedy of potential food shortages in the future. More than 90% of Korean consumers wanted GM foods to be labeled as such. More than 50% of the respondents would not buy until they know more about GM foods. Only 35.8% of Korean consumers were found to know that food items originating from plants contained genes. More consumers responded that they would not buy herbicide-resistant GM soybean but buy vitamin-enriched GM soybean. Many Korean consumers' decision of acceptance or rejection of GM foods depend not on the basis of biotechnology, but on the basis of the degree of benefit to the consumers. Only 6.4% of Korean consumers responded that GM foods were the greatest threat to the safety of Korean foods. The perception of Korean consumers on GM foods has not changed significantly during the past 5 years.

        The purpose of this study was to measure the effects of trust, knowledge, optimism, risk and benefits on consumer attitudes toward genetically modified foods. A total of 326 questionnaires were completed. Moderated regression analysis was used to measure the relationships among the variables. The analysis results for the data indicated a good model fit in Model 2 rather than Model 1, in which the direct effects of trust, optimism and benefits had statistically significant direct effects on the respondents' attitudes toward genetically modified foods, while the direct effects of knowledge and risk were not statistically significant. As expected, the interaction term of risk and benefit had a significant effect on consumer attitude. Moreover, the effect of risk on consumer's attitude toward genetically modified foods was statistically significant at all levels of benefit, except at the lower benefit level. Finally, the results of this study indicated that genetically modified food developers and marketers should attach importance to the interaction effect of benefits to understand the elements of market demand and customer loyalty.

        유전자재조합식품과 관련된 담당 총무원 및 기타 전문가들의 인지도출 조사하기 위해서 설문조사를 실시하였다. 응답자들을 근무년수별, 소속별, 업무별로 분류하였으며 설문지의 각 문항에 대한 결과는 위 분류별로 통계분석하여 빈도수 및 응답률로 나타내었다. 조사 결과, 유전자재조차식품에 대해 들어본 경험은 95% 이상으로 나타났으며, 유전자재조합식품의 혜택은 식량난 해결이라고 가장 만이 응답하였다. 유선자재조합식품의 표시에 대해서는 '90% 이상이 표시해야 한다' 또는 '가급적 표시해야 한다'로 응답하석 식품위생공무원 및 기타 전문가들은 유전자재조합 표시를 절실히 필요로 하고 있었으며 학력 수준 및 전문 수준이 높을수록 구입하여 먹을 의향이 높은 것으로 나타났다. 응답자 대부분은 근무년수별, 소속별, 업무별 구분에 상관없이 기본적인 지식은 있는 것으로 나타났으나 시·도 공무원 및 국립검역소 그룹은 다른 전문가 그룹에 비해서 유선자재조합식품에 대한 정보가 부족한 깃으로 나타났다. 유전자재조합식품에 대한 안전성 인식은 대제로 안전하다는 견해를 가지고 있었으나 20년 이상 근무자와 일반 행정 업무자는 다른 그룹에 비매시 안신하지 않거나 불안하다는 견해를 더 많이 나타냈다 식품의 안전성을 위협하는 가장 큰 요인은 ‘식품취급 부주의 및 취급 불량'으로 응답하였으며, 유전자재조합식품이 위협요인이라고 응답한 사람은 매우 적었나(4.4%). 결론적으로 유전자재조합식품 관련 공무원 및 기타 전문가들은 일반시민들에 비해서 섭취나 안전성에 보다 긍정적인 견해를 나타냈지만 생물학 지식에 대해서는 그룹별 차이가 있었으며 유전자재조한식품에 대한 민인업무 치리에 어려운 점을 겪고 있는 것으로 보아 관련 전문가들에게도 교육 및 홍보가 필요한 것으로 파악되었다
